I have the 18-55mm, the 56mm and the 35mm 1.4. So I don't havve the lenses you mentioned.

I feel it depends on what kind of shooter you are. If you want a shallow dept of field for portraits and shoor in very low light. F1.2 is very very nice, but this lens is not an indoor action lens.

I thi k the 18-55mm is a very good walk around lens. yes you miss one stop at the long end, but it's light and has OIS.

from what I have read and watched on youtube the 35mm F2 is small, fast and sharp. and it has F2 so a bit better then the F2.8 of the 16-55mm which is big and heavy and doesn;t have OIS. 55-200 has extra reach. That's allways a bonus.

So 35mm and 55-200mm if you ask me. Unless you love the shallow depth of field portrait look. without a battery grip I think the 16-55 is a bit bulky.
